為什麼檔名對網站很重要?
檔名在網站中扮演著關鍵角色,不僅影響SEO,還影響網站的可讀性和文件管理效率。對於一個網站來說,清晰而有意義的檔名能幫助搜尋引擎更好地索引和理解檔案內容,進而提升網站的搜尋引擎排名。例如,使用帶有相關關鍵字的檔名,如 product-guide.pdf
,可以讓搜尋引擎知道檔案的用途,進一步提高用戶搜尋相關內容時的能見度。
此外,檔名的可讀性對用戶體驗和內部管理也同樣重要。如果檔名過於混亂或使用非標準字元,不僅會讓管理檔案變得困難,也可能導致網站訪問問題,特別是在不同的伺服器環境中。統一使用有意義且簡單的檔名,有助於網站管理人員快速辨識檔案內容,提升日常運作效率。
因此,在 WordPress 等網站建置平台中,建議使用英文檔名。相較於非英文檔名,英文檔名能有效避免編碼問題,增強檔案在不同伺服器和設備上的相容性,並提高網站的專業形象。
使用英文檔名的優勢
避免編碼問題
非英文檔名在網站運行中可能引發許多潛在的編碼問題,特別是在伺服器和外掛的相容性方面。某些伺服器或系統可能無法正確處理非英文檔名,導致檔案無法正確顯示,甚至連結失效。例如,當網站遷移到新的伺服器時,原本包含中文或其他非英文字符的檔案可能出現亂碼,進而影響用戶體驗和網站的正常運行。使用英文檔名能有效避免這些問題,確保檔案在各種環境中的相容性,讓網站運行更穩定。
提升SEO效果
英文檔名對於提升網站的SEO表現具有顯著的幫助。搜尋引擎在抓取網站內容時,更容易解析英文檔名中的關鍵字,進一步理解檔案的內容。例如,將圖片檔名設置為 organic-food-tips.jpg
,比起 圖片1.jpg
更能讓搜尋引擎知道該檔案的主題是有機食品建議,從而提升搜尋結果的相關性。建議在命名檔案時,使用與內容密切相關的英文關鍵字,這不僅有助於SEO,還能吸引更多目標受眾點擊網站。
簡化文件管理
英文檔名在不同系統和平台上都能更加方便地管理和操作。對於網站管理者或團隊協作而言,統一使用英文檔名可以減少溝通中的混淆。例如,在共享檔案時,英文檔名能更直觀地反映檔案內容,而非英文檔名則可能導致辨識困難。特別是在國際化團隊中,使用英文檔名能提高工作效率,避免因語言差異導致的錯誤或延誤。
總之,使用英文檔名不僅有助於解決技術問題,還能優化SEO和簡化網站管理,為網站的運行和成長提供穩定的基礎。這是一個容易執行但影響深遠的最佳實踐,值得每位網站管理者採用。
非英文檔名可能帶來的問題
伺服器相容性問題
非英文檔名在某些伺服器或主機環境中可能導致相容性問題,這是網站管理者經常遇到的挑戰之一。某些伺服器可能無法正確處理包含中文、日文或其他非拉丁字符的檔案,導致這些檔案無法正常加載或存取。特別是在網站搬家時,如果伺服器的編碼設定與檔案名稱不相符,可能會出現亂碼或檔案丟失的情況。這些問題不僅影響網站的正常運行,還可能導致用戶體驗下降。為了確保伺服器相容性,統一使用英文檔名是一個簡單而有效的解決方案。
瀏覽器顯示異常
非英文檔名在某些瀏覽器中可能導致文件無法正常顯示,特別是在較舊版本的瀏覽器或不支持特定語言編碼的情況下。例如,當用戶嘗試下載或查看包含非英文檔名的文件時,瀏覽器可能會無法解析檔名,從而出現錯誤提示或文件無法打開的問題。這不僅降低了用戶對網站的信任度,還可能影響網站的轉換率。使用英文檔名能有效避免這些瀏覽器顯示異常的情況,確保所有用戶都能順利訪問網站內容。
外掛或工具的限制
許多 WordPress 外掛或功能對非英文檔名的支援有限,這也是非英文檔名的一個主要缺點。例如,一些圖片壓縮外掛可能無法正確處理非英文檔案名稱,導致壓縮失敗或檔案損壞。同樣,某些SEO工具在生成網站地圖時,可能會因無法解析非英文檔名而跳過相關文件,進一步影響網站的搜尋引擎表現。為了確保外掛和工具的正常運行,建議所有檔案命名時使用簡單且清晰的英文名稱。
總之,非英文檔名在伺服器、瀏覽器和工具的相容性上都可能帶來潛在風險。透過統一使用英文檔名,不僅能提高網站的穩定性和兼容性,還能減少技術問題,為網站的長期運營提供保障。
如何正確命名檔案?
使用簡單、相關的英文單字
選擇能夠準確描述內容的英文單字來命名檔案,不僅能讓檔名更具可讀性,還能幫助搜尋引擎更好地理解檔案的用途。例如,對於促銷活動的圖片,可以使用檔名 summer_sale.jpg
,而非隨機命名的 img123.jpg
;對於表單檔案,則可以使用 contact_form.php
而非 newfile.php
。這種做法有助於快速辨識檔案內容,特別是在需要管理大量檔案時,簡單、相關的檔名能節省時間並提高效率。
避免空格與特殊字元
空格和特殊字元在檔案命名中可能導致技術問題,特別是在URL中,空格會自動轉換為 %20
,使檔名看起來不夠直觀且影響可讀性。同時,某些特殊字元(如 @
、#
或 &
)可能無法在所有伺服器和系統中正常處理,甚至會導致檔案無法正確載入。為避免這些問題,建議使用連字號(-
)或底線(_
)來替代空格,例如 product-list.jpg
或 user_profile.png
,這種做法既符合技術需求,又能保持檔名的清晰結構。
確保檔名簡短而有意義
過長或模糊的檔名會降低管理效率,也可能在某些情況下被截斷或無法正確顯示。為了平衡檔名的長度和描述性,建議限制檔名在3到5個單字內,並確保檔名清晰表達其內容。例如,blog_post_tips.jpg
比 blog_image_for_post_tips_in_july2024.jpg
更直觀易懂。此外,避免使用過於籠統的檔名,如 image.jpg
或 file.doc
,這類命名方式不僅增加管理難度,還可能導致檔案覆蓋的風險。
總結來說,正確命名檔案不僅是提升網站管理效率的重要步驟,還能增強SEO表現和用戶體驗。透過使用簡單的英文單字、避免空格與特殊字元以及保持檔名簡短且有意義,您可以為網站的長期運營建立良好的基礎。
如何批量更改檔名?
手動方法
對於檔名數量較少的情況,手動更改是一個簡單且有效的選擇。以下是操作步驟:
- Windows 使用者:
- 打開檔案所在的資料夾,選中需要修改的檔案。
- 按下 F2 鍵 進入重新命名模式,輸入新的檔名。
- 如果需要批量重新命名,選擇多個檔案後右鍵點擊,選擇 重新命名,系統會自動為檔案添加編號,如
image(1).jpg
、image(2).jpg
。
- macOS 使用者:
- 選取多個需要更改的檔案後,右鍵點擊並選擇 重新命名項目。
- 使用內建的批量更改功能,根據需求添加前綴、後綴或改變檔名格式,如將
file123.png
改為product_123.png
。
手動方法適合數量較少且結構簡單的檔案,但若檔案數量過多,可能會增加時間成本,建議使用工具來提高效率。
使用外掛工具
對於使用 WordPress 平台的網站管理者來說,批量更改檔名可以透過專業的外掛工具完成。以下是一些推薦的外掛及其功能介紹:
- Media File Renamer:
- 這款外掛可以根據文件的標題自動重新命名檔案,或讓用戶手動更改檔名。
- 支援批量處理功能,適合需要一次性修改大量檔案的情況。
- 外掛還能自動更新檔名相關的連結,確保不影響網站的正常運行。
- Enable Media Replace:
- 此外掛的主要功能是替換現有的媒體檔案,但也支援更改檔名。
- 能夠快速找到目標檔案並進行重新命名,特別適合需要維護媒體庫的網站。
操作建議:
- 在使用外掛前,務必對網站進行完整備份,以防止操作不當導致數據丟失或連結失效。
- 測試外掛的批量更改功能,確保結果符合網站的需求。
透過手動方法或專業工具,網站管理者能高效地完成檔名批量更改,確保網站內容井然有序並提升管理效率。對於擁有大量檔案的網站,外掛工具無疑是最佳選擇。
常見問題
已經有許多非英文檔名,該怎麼辦?
如果您的網站已經存在大量非英文檔名,您可以採取以下解決方法:
- 批量重新命名:使用專業工具或外掛(如 Media File Renamer)批量更改檔案名稱為英文,確保檔名規範。
- 更新檔案連結:在更改檔名後,確保檢查並更新所有與檔案相關的連結,以避免出現 404 錯誤。
- 備份網站:在進行任何檔名更改之前,務必對網站進行完整備份,確保在遇到問題時可以迅速恢復。
- 使用網站掃描工具:在更改完成後,使用 SEO 工具(如 Screaming Frog 或 Google Search Console)檢查網站是否有損壞的連結。
透過這些步驟,您可以有效解決非英文檔名帶來的技術問題,同時確保網站的穩定性。
英文檔名會不會影響用戶體驗?
英文檔名對於前端用戶體驗的影響幾乎可以忽略不計。大多數情況下,訪問者無需直接與檔名互動,他們更關注內容是否清晰和功能是否正常運行。以下是一些補充說明:
- 瀏覽器顯示:現代瀏覽器會自動處理英文檔名,確保用戶能順利下載或查看檔案。
- 下載檔案:雖然非英文檔名可能顯得更貼近某些地區的用戶,但英文檔名更具普適性,能在全球範圍內提供一致的用戶體驗。
因此,使用英文檔名不僅能減少技術障礙,還能提升網站在國際市場上的相容性。
多語言網站應如何處理檔名?
多語言網站在處理檔名時,需要平衡技術需求和用戶需求,以下是幾點建議:
- 統一使用英文檔名:無論網站包含多少種語言,統一使用英文檔名有助於降低伺服器和工具的相容性問題。例如,將法文版的圖片命名為
product_overview_fr.jpg
,德文版則為product_overview_de.jpg
。 - 添加語言標識:在檔名中加入語言代碼,以區分不同語言的文件,例如
manual_en.pdf
和manual_zh.pdf
。 - 工具支持:使用專業的多語言管理工具(如 WPML 或 TranslatePress),確保在翻譯網站內容時,同步管理檔名和連結。
這些做法能幫助多語言網站在技術上保持一致性,並提供最佳的用戶體驗。
透過批量重新命名、優化檔案連結以及統一的命名規範,網站管理者能輕鬆應對非英文檔名帶來的挑戰。英文檔名既能提升網站技術相容性,又能滿足多語言需求,是網站長期運營的理想選擇。
延伸閱讀: